Neu Fehler mit Zugriff auf die Datenbank (Exec Direct).

realitor

Aktives Mitglied
14. Januar 2013
70
18
Ich bitte um Unterstützung.

Ergänzungen / Änderungen am Beitrag:
  • Die Wawi-Version "Neue Oberfläche" funktioniert einwandfrei. Die normale Version nicht. Egal ob direkt auf dem Rechner mit dem SQL-Server oder einem PC im Netzwerk.
  • Das Anlegen eines Mandanten mit dem JTL-DB-Tool und das direkte Einspielen eines Backups (egal wie groß / klein oder welche Version) bricht mit demselben Fehler ab.
Ausgangslage:
  • Ein bestehender Server wird mit JTL 1.9.4.6 und SQL2019 verwendet.
  • Ein neuer Server wurde mit SQL2022 Standard bereitgestellt.
Vorgehensweise:
  1. Backup wurde von SQL2019 Quellcomputer zu SQL2022 Zielcomputer übertragen.
  2. JTL 1.9.4.6 wurde auf dem Zielcomputer installiert.
  3. Nach der Anmeldung endet JTL mit einem Fehler "Fehler mit Zugriff auf die Datenbank (Exec Direct)."
    [Fehlerprotokoll: Unbehandelte Ausnahme #761E037A5E9D6536 vom Typ jtlCore.Classes.CppConnector.CppException in jtlCore.Classes.CppConnector.CppException: Fehler beim Zugriff auf die Datenbank (Exec Direct).]
  4. Alle Aktivitäten wurden innerhalb Windowssitzung als Administrator unter Server 2022 Standard ohne aktive Domäne (mit und ohne Remote).
  5. Zum Zeitpunkt des Fehlers sind keine Fehlereinträge beim SQL-Server-Log oder in den Ereignisprotokollen des Windows-Server sichtbar.
  6. Das Profil wurde mit und ohne dynamische Ports mit folgenden Varianten getestet:
    1. Ip,Port\Instanzname
    2. Servername,Port\Instanzname
    3. Ip\Instanzname,Port
    4. Servername\Instanzname,Port
Maßnahmen:
  • Mehrere Versuche und Überprüfungen brachten keine Verbesserung. Dazu zählten auch die Überprüfung des SA-Nutzers, des DBO-Schemas und den Grundeinstellungen des SQL-Servers. Die gemischte Anmeldung ist aktiviert.
  • Auch das Neuanlagen der Datenbank eazybusiness im neuen Server oder das Verwenden der aktuellsten JTL-Version 1.9.5.4 brachte keine Änderung. Das Update von 1.9.4.6 zu 1.9.5.4 ist mit leerer Datenbank oder Bestandsdatenbank (183 GB) fehlerfrei.
  • Individuelle Abfragen im SMSS ( Konsole sind fehlerfrei. Prozeduren könnten fehlerfrei ausgeführt werden.
  • Die Instanz ist im Netzwerk erreichbar.
  • Eine eigene C#-Anwendung mit SQL-Zugriff und eigener Datenbank in der selben Instanz wurden installiert und funktionieren.
  • Der SQL-Server wurde neu installiert und Grundeinstellungen vorgenommen.
Dabei sind folgende Auffälligkeiten bemerkt worden.
  1. Beim Anlegen des Mandanten muss der Expertenmodus und zwingend Pfade für mdf und ndf gewählt werden. Dabei stand auf dem Laufwerk C: nur der JTL-Installationsordner zur Wahl. Das JTL-Datenbank-Tool hatte also nur Zugriff auf den eigenen Installationsordner. Alle anderen Laufwerke waren verfügbar. Auch bei Wahl eines individuellen Ordners auf einem anderen Datenträger führte zum selben Fehler.
  2. Trotz des Fehlers ist die Anwendungen JTL-WMS und JTL-Ameise fehlerfrei und erlaubt alle denkbaren Interaktionen, sofern nicht die Lizenzabfrage störte.
 
Zuletzt bearbeitet:

mh1

Sehr aktives Mitglied
4. Oktober 2020
1.768
536
Schau dir mal mit dem SQL-Profiler an, welche SQL Befehle bis zum Zeitpunkt des Abbruchs an den Server übertragen werden. Vielleicht kommst du dann eher dahinter, was den Fehler verursacht.
 
  • Gefällt mir
Reaktionen: realitor

realitor

Aktives Mitglied
14. Januar 2013
70
18
Vielen Dank für den Hinweis.

Dieser Merge wird nicht mehr ausgeführt. Die Spalte cValue mit dem Schlüssel cKey (AnonymousWawiSeed) enthält den vorherigen Wert. Der unmittelbar vorher stattfindende Merge auf tOptions setzt den WawiSeed erfolgreich. Bei jedem Login wird versucht den AnonymousWawiSeed mit einem neuen Wert zu belegen.

Code:
exec sp_executesql N'
MERGE INTO
eazybusiness.dbo.tOptions AS myTarget
USING (VALUES (@Key, @Value)) AS mySource(cKey, cValue)
ON mySource.cKey = myTarget.cKey
WHEN NOT MATCHED BY TARGET THEN
INSERT (cKey, cValue) VALUES (mySource.cKey, mySource.cValue);
SELECT
cValue
FROM
eazybusiness.dbo.tOptions
WHERE
cKey = @Key;',N'@key nvarchar(500),@value nvarchar(500)',@key=N'AnonymousWawiSeed',@value=N'81C9965E67082295'

Danach erzeugt der Transactionsmanager Einträge und in der Folge werden die Daten für das Fehlerprotokoll gesammelt.
 

mh1

Sehr aktives Mitglied
4. Oktober 2020
1.768
536
Der Code, den du da postet sieht aber nicht nach einem Dump vom SQL Profiler aus. Was hast du denn da ausgelesen?

Aber wie auch immer, was ich aus dem was du schickst so vermute, ist das in deiner Datenbank in tOptions solch ein Datensatz angelegt ist:
cKey: AnonymousWawiSeed und cValue: irgendwas ungleich 81C9965E67082295

Ist alles so ein bisschen stochern im Nebel, aber ich würde jetzt erstmal tippen dein Client sendet halt einen AnonymousWawiSeed, der nicht dem entspricht, der in der Datenbank steht.
Ich würde jetzt auf dem Client ein neues Datenbankprofil anlegen.
 
Ähnliche Themen
Titel Forum Antworten Datum
Hood SCX Schnittstelle mit Listing Fehler JTL-Wawi 1.10 1
Neu DHL Labels kommen sehr stark verzögert raus oder Fehler: "Die HTTP-Anforderung wurde mit Clientauthentifizierungsschema "Anonymous" nicht zugelassen." JTL-ShippingLabels - Fehler und Bugs 1
Neu Mit Ameize nutze: Freie Position zum Auftrag hinzufügen verursacht Fehler JTL-Ameise - Fehler und Bugs 3
Neu Barrierefreiheit WAVE-Report mit 1 Kontrast-Fehler im Auswahlmenü Templates für JTL-Shop 1
Neu Fehler Erstabgleich - Konflikt mit der FOREIGN KEY-Einschränkung Shopify-Connector 2
Neu Fehler beim Aktualisieren einer bestehenden Bestellung mit Ameize JTL-Ameise - Fehler und Bugs 16
Neu unicorn2 Etsy listen nicht möglich - Fehler Artikelgewicht Schnittstellen Import / Export 5
Neu Fehler bei Versandbestätigung seit 28.07.2025 Amazon-Anbindung - Fehler und Bugs 1
Neu PHP message: PHP Fatal error -> Seite nicht mehr aufrufbar (Fehler 500) Installation / Updates von JTL-Shop 1
Neu Shopify-Connector: Fehler "delivery_note table doesn't exist" beim Lieferschein-Abgleich Shopify-Connector 4
Neu FEHLER: eBay-Auktionen Upload nicht möglich, Fehlercodes helfen nicht weiter [Error 21917328 & 21920203] eBay-Anbindung - Fehler und Bugs 2
Neu Unnötiger Fehler beim Import von Kundendaten JTL-Shop - Fehler und Bugs 0
Neu Dringendes Problem: Bildabgleich nach Connector-Fix – "Parameter resourceUrl is empty" Fehler Shopify-Connector 4
Abgleich wird abgebrochen durch diesen Fehler Shopify-Connector 7
Neu Worker macht Fehler nach Update. kein Abgleich möglich Betrieb / Pflege von JTL-Shop 1
Neu Fehler Sie können aktuell keine Benutzer-Lizenzen für WMS bzw. WMS Mobile buchen Installation von JTL-WMS / JTL-Packtisch+ 9
Neu Fehler bei Abgleich WooCommerce-Connector 1
Neu EAN Fehler beim Etikettendruck User helfen Usern - Fragen zu JTL-Wawi 5
Neu Shopware 6.6.10.2 Abgleich zu JTL | Bilder Übertragung Fehler: Path cannot be empty Shopware-Connector 0
GLS-Retourenlabel – Fehler bei Feld 'Name1', obwohl DPD funktioniert JTL-Wawi 1.9 0
Neu Ständig wiederkehrender Fehler beim Ableich des Lister 2.0 Amazon-Lister - Fehler und Bugs 5
Zahlungsmodul - PayPal Fehler: kein lauschender Endpunkt JTL-Wawi 1.9 0
Neu Fehler beim JTL-Worker – "Der Remoteserver hat einen Fehler zurückgegeben: (502) Ungültiges Gateway" (Shopify) JTL-Wawi - Fehler und Bugs 2
Neu DHL Fehler "Großkundenempfänger" JTL-ShippingLabels - Fehler und Bugs 0
Neu JTL Debug 2.0.4 und Shop 5.5.2 - Fehler 500 Plugins für JTL-Shop 3
Neu NOVA Theme Fehler - 5.5.2 JTL-Shop - Fehler und Bugs 0
Neu Upload-Dateien: Fehler beim Abgleich Onlineshop-Anbindung 0
Neu Paypal Plugin läßt sich nicht installieren - SQL Fehler Plugins für JTL-Shop 2
Neu Plugin Fehler JTL-Shop - Fehler und Bugs 7
Fehler in der JTL-Wawi-Anzeige, ob ein Artikel bereits einem Onlineshop zugeordnet wurde. JTL-Wawi 1.10 5
Neu Fehler DHL Auslandsversand JTL-ShippingLabels - Fehler und Bugs 12
Neu Otto Import über Eazyauction - Fehler 100096 - SWITCH_API_VERSION User helfen Usern - Fragen zu JTL-Wawi 16
Neu Export der Artikel - Fehler beim Export!? JTL-POS - Fehler und Bugs 0
In Diskussion Workflow kurze Pause per Batch - Fehler "Die Eingabeumleitung wird nicht unterstützt" JTL-Workflows - Ideen, Lob und Kritik 6
Fehler beim Belegabruf JTL2Datev aus JTL / "Belegkopf-ExtAuftrag...." JTL-Wawi 1.10 2
Neu Fehler Meldung beim Abgleich Shopware-Connector 4
Neu Fehler bei Anbindung JTL Wawi und JTL Shop 5 JTL-Shop - Fehler und Bugs 1
Neu Connector funktioniert seit Fehler E-Mail nicht mehr Shopify-Connector 3
Neu Update von 1.9.8.0 auf 1.10.11.0 läuft auf Fehler JTL-Wawi - Fehler und Bugs 2
Neu Anbindung JTL-Connecor an WooCommerce nicht möglich - JSON-Fehler in der WAWI WooCommerce-Connector 2
Neu DATEV Rechnungsdatenservice 2.0 vs. 1.10.10.3 WAWI fehler!? JTL-Wawi - Fehler und Bugs 14
Neu 1.10.11.0 - Fehler - Artikel - Filter JTL-Wawi - Fehler und Bugs 0
Import Fehler! Der Vorgang wurde abgebrochen! JTL-Wawi 1.10 24
xRechnung - Fehler IBAN JTL-Wawi 1.10 5
In Diskussion Rechnung per mail / Workflow gibt Fehler aus JTL-Workflows - Fehler und Bugs 6
Neu Shopify Connector Fehler bezüglich "unique key" bei den Kategorien Shopify-Connector 5
Neu JTL wawi Fehler beim Zugriff auf die Datenbank / Datenbankverwaltung aber funktioniert Installation von JTL-Wawi 3
Neu Fehler bei der Datenbank Sicherung Export JTL-Wawi - Fehler und Bugs 3
Neu "Die ConnectionString-Eigenschaft wurde nicht initialisiert" Fehler bei Zugriff über VPN JTL-Wawi - Fehler und Bugs 6
Neu Kontaktformular – „Bitte warten Sie einen Moment“-Fehler Allgemeine Fragen zu JTL-Shop 3

Ähnliche Themen